精品资料2022年收藏职工工资管理课程设计

上传人:ni****g 文档编号:470721049 上传时间:2023-01-16 格式:DOC 页数:22 大小:286.51KB
返回 下载 相关 举报
精品资料2022年收藏职工工资管理课程设计_第1页
第1页 / 共22页
精品资料2022年收藏职工工资管理课程设计_第2页
第2页 / 共22页
精品资料2022年收藏职工工资管理课程设计_第3页
第3页 / 共22页
精品资料2022年收藏职工工资管理课程设计_第4页
第4页 / 共22页
精品资料2022年收藏职工工资管理课程设计_第5页
第5页 / 共22页
点击查看更多>>
资源描述

《精品资料2022年收藏职工工资管理课程设计》由会员分享,可在线阅读,更多相关《精品资料2022年收藏职工工资管理课程设计(22页珍藏版)》请在金锄头文库上搜索。

1、长治学院课程设计报告课程名称: 软件工程课程设计 设计题目: 职工工资管理系统 系 别: 计算机系 专 业: 计算机科学与技术 组 别: 第10组 学生姓名: 杨学安 学 号: # 起止日期: 2010年07月04日-2010年07月11日 指导教师: 赵秀梅 20目 录1.可行性研究11.1问题描述11.2开发背景及意义11.3应用范围21.4开发工具22.系统需求分析22.1问题现状22.2用户对系统的功能需求22.3用户对系统的性能需求32.4 系统功能模块图解32.5系统数据流图42.6数据字典62.7系统数据分析82.8实体-联系图93. 概要设计104.详细设计114.1数据库设计

2、114.2数据库表结构124.3主要模块的流程图145.编码165.1主要代码165.2 测试176.总结18参考文献191.可行性研究1.1问题描述 企业工资管理是一项琐碎、复杂而又十分细致的工作,一般不允许发生差错。最初的工资统计和发放都是使用人工方式处理,工作量大的时候,出现错误的机率也随之升高,不仅花费财务人员大量的时间,而且往往由于抄写不慎,或者由于计算的疏忽,出现工资发放错误的现象。同时工资的发放具有较强的时间限制,必须严格按照单位规定的时间完成计算和发放工作。正是企业工资管理的这种重复性、规律性、时间性,使得企业工资管理计算机化成为可能。企业工资管理系统就是使用电脑代替大量的人工

3、统计和计算,完成众多企业工资信息的处理,同时使用电脑还可以安全地、完整地保存大量的企业工资记录。1.2开发背景及意义 企业的工资管理是公司管理的一个重要内容。随着企业人员数量增加,企业的工资管理工作也变得越来越复杂。工资管理既涉及到企业劳动人事的管理,同时也是企业财务管理的重要组成部分。工资管理需要和人事管理相联系,同时连接工时考勤和医疗保险等等,来生成企业每个职工的基本工资、津贴、医疗保险、保险费、实际发放工资等。资金是企业生存的主要元素,资金的流动影响到企业的整体运作,企业职工的工资是企业资金管理的一个重要的组成部分。早期的工资统计和发放都是使用人工方式处理纸质材料,不仅花费财务人员大量的

4、时间且不易保存,往往由于个人的因素抄写不慎或计算疏忽,出现工资发放错误的现象。基于以上原因,企业工资管理系统使用电脑安全保存、快速计算、全面统计,实现工资管理的系统化、规范化、自动化。企业工资管理系统是典型的信息管理系统,前台程序开发工具采用PB,后台数据库采用SQL 2000数据库。运行结果证明,本企业工资管理系统极大提高了工作效率,节省了人力和物力,最终满足企业财务管理、职工工资发放的需要,同时也成为现代化企业管理的标志。1.3应用范围实现工资的集中管理。可供财务人员对本单位的人员以及工资进行增加、删除、修改、查询,对人事的管理及工资发放中的应发工资合计等项目由系统自动进行计算;同时本系统

5、还可对人事及工资管理情况进行多角度查询。1.4开发工具 数据库:SQL 2000数据库; 开发工具: power builder 9.0程序开发工具2.系统需求分析2.1问题现状 随着经济的发展,企业向着大型化、规模化发展,而对于大中型企业,职工、职称等都跟工资管理有关的信息随之急剧增加。在这种情况下单靠人工来处理职工的工资不但显得力不从心,而且极容易出错。该系统就是设计一个小型企业工资的管理系统,由计算机代替人工执行一系列诸如增加新职工,删除旧职工,工资查询,统计等操作。这样就使办公人员可以轻松快捷地完成工资管理的任务。2.2用户对系统的功能需求经过分析研究,确定了用户对系统的主要功能需求有

6、:(1)查询子系统:职工资料查询,职工部门查询,职工工资查询。 (2)数据库管理子系统:职工基本信息管理,部门信息管理,用户信息管理。(3)统计分析:统计职工出勤情况,职工奖励情况查询 本人负责的模块是职工信息管理,包括职工基本基本信息、基本工资、静态工资、动态工资的录入以及奖惩信息登记。2.3用户对系统的性能需求一般的性能需求是指相互消息传递顺利,协议分析正确,界面友好,运行时间满足使用需要,安全性得到完全保证。 1稳定性:本系统面对的是大量的职工,一旦服务器发生阻塞而崩溃将带来很大的麻烦和问题。系统服务器的及时响应也是服务质量的重要指标,太长的延迟时间将给工作带来不便。由于数据量大,必须对

7、数据及时备份与恢复。 2安全性:通过提供信息的机密性、完整性提供充分的保护来预防风险,保障系统安全。对职工工资管理系统而言,除了保护系统免受恶意攻击,还要防止职工信息泄漏。3可扩展性:系统要满足用户需求和业务复杂性要求。主要表现在用户数量以及提供的用户服务的复杂性和集成性等方面,系统要随着用户的要求和技术的不断发展改进。因此系统可扩展性非常必要。 4易于管理:可以很方便的对系统进行管理,确保系统正常运行,同时系统的管理和监控可以在远程完成 5. 一致性:系统数据要保证一致性、准确性,当某一数据库中记录改变,与之相关联的数据库也随之变化。 就实际情况,在高系统配置、内部控制很容易得到保证的情况下

8、,我们最需要考虑的性能需求就是系统安全性问题。在开发系统的每个阶段,需要一种方法来决定允许特定用户进行什么样的操作。2.4 系统功能模块图解本系统功能模块如下图2.1所示:职工工资管理系统数据库管理子系统帮助子系统统计分析查询子系统图2.1功能模块职工基本信息管理功能模块如下图2-2所示:职工基本信息管理职工基本信息的录入职工基本工资的录入奖惩信息登记(奖励、考勤)职工变动工资录入职工固定工资录入图2.2 职工信息管理模块2.5系统数据流图职工工资管理系统是企事业单位管理的重要组成部分,我们结合目前教职工工资管理的现状,经过充分的研究和综合分析,开发了职工工资管理系统。该系统的数据流图如下:顶

9、层数据流图:查询、更新、录入查询,登记(考勤)职工工资管理系统职工管理员密码管理修改密码 图2.3 系统顶层数据流图细化的数据流图:查询子系统 查询查询 录入、更新 登记、更新数据库管理子系统管理员用户 统计查询查询统计分析 帮助子系统 图2.4 系统数据流图职工信息管理功能模块的数据流图:职工信息管理模块:收集信息,登记职工信息的录入 管理员统计,登记职工工资的录入 登记出勤登记职工 奖惩信息登记奖惩表工资基本表工资表职工表图2.5 职工基本信息功能模块数据流图2.6数据字典经过以上综合分析,设计出后台数据库的数据字典如下:1 数据项:职工编号 含义说明:唯一标识一个职工的身份 类型:文本

10、长度:6 前三位为部门号,后三位为职工号 2 数据项:职工姓名 含义说明:职工称谓 类型:文本 长度:8 最多为复姓,四汉字姓名 3. 数据项:性别 含义说明:职工性别 类型:文本 长度:2 限制值为男或女4. 数据项:出生年月 含义说明:职工的出生日期类型:日期型 取值范围:1900-1-12000-12-315. 数据项:文化程度 含义说明:职工文化程度 类型:文本 长度:86 数据项:部门编号 含义说明:标识某一部门 类型:文本 长度:37 数据项:职称 含义说明:标识职工的具体工作 类型:文本 长度:108 数据项:年月 含义说明:职工工资的日期 类型:日期型 9. 数据项:实发工资

11、含义说明:职工每月最终获得薪水类型:货币型 取值范围: 大于010. 数据项:基本工资 含义说明:职工每月最终获得薪水类型:货币型 取值范围:大于011. 数据项:高房租 含义说明:职工所支付的住房租金 类型:货币型 取值范围:大于等于012. 数据项:独生子女费 含义说明:独生子女家庭职工获得的补助类型:货币型 取值范围:大于等于013. 数据项:工资福利 含义说明:职工所获得的工资福利 类型:货币型 取值范围:大于等于014. 数据项:医疗保险 含义说明:存储在职工医疗卡的薪水 类型:货币型 取值范围:大于等于015. 数据项:公积金 含义说明:存储在职工基金卡的薪水 类型:货币型 取值范围:大于等于016. 数据项:罚金 含义说明:因缺勤而扣发的薪水 类型:货币型 取值范围:大于等于017. 数据项:奖金 含义说明:因获取奖项而奖励的金额类型:货币型 取值范围:大于等于018. 数据项:津贴 含义说明:职工每月获得的补助 类型:货币型 取值范围:大于等于019. 数据项:缺勤次数 含义说明:职工签到的次数 类型:数值型 取值范围:大于等于020. 数据项:获取奖项数 含义说明:职工获取奖项的次数

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 医学/心理学 > 基础医学

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号